We're building forward, together.
The Red Deer Regional Hospital Centre (RDRHC) Redevelopment Project (Project) is a $1.8-billion investment that will upgrade services throughout the hospital and add significant capacity.
There are two major components of this Project:
construction of a new patient tower, and renovations and upgrades throughout the existing building
construction of an ambulatory building (across 39th Street from the parkade)
Highlights of the Project and its components include:
the addition of 200 new beds in the patient tower.
six new operating rooms.
two cardiac catheterization labs.
an expanded Medical Device Reprocessing Department.
outpatient services, addiction and mental health, renal dialysis and underground parking at the ambulatory building
As the project progresses, programs, services and their equipment will be relocated within the site to accommodate construction and renovations.
The new patient tower and the ambulatory building will be completed before the finalization of the total redevelopment project, which is expected to be completed and fully commissioned by 2031.

Located at 3942 50A Avenue in Red Deer, Red Deer Regional Hospital Centre (RDRHC) provides specialized healthcare services to people across central Alberta. As the only regional referral centre in the AHS Central Zone - which spans the area between Drumheller and Two Hills and from Saskatchewan to the Rocky Mountains – the site is critical in delivering health services to Albertans of all ages.
